Incident Summary:

10/14/2020: Assailants stormed a civilian residence in Gurziwan district, Faryab, Afghanistan. Two civilians who provided food and water to security forces were killed during the incident. This was one of two attacks carried out by the same assailants in Gurziwan district on the same day. No group claimed responsibility for the incident; however, sources attributed the attack to the Taliban.
